Step 1: Initial Assessment

Our team will arrive at your property within 60 minutes to assess the damage and find out the best course of action.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ify any potential hazards.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our technicians will use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ract as much water as possible from your property. We’ll also use specialized equipment to remove any standing water and dry out affected areas.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to dry out your property and prevent further damage. We’ll also use specialized equipment to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old growth.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

Our team will use specialized equipment to sanitize and disinfect your property, removing any b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ants that may have been left behind.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air

Once the drying and sanitizing process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is safe and secure. We’ll also identify any areas that need repair and provide a detailed estimate for the work.

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Flooded Basement No Yes It’s not safe to navigate a flooded basement, and DIY equipment may not be powerful enough to remove all the water.
Small Leak Under Sink Yes No A small leak under the sink is usually an easy fix and can be handled with DIY equipment.
Burst Pipe in Attic No Yes A burst pipe in the attic can cause significant damage and is best handled by a professional with the right equipment.
Standing Water in Garage No Yes Standing water in a garage can be hazardous and needs professional equipment to remove safely and efficiently.
Water Damage from Roof Leak No Yes Water damage from a roof leak need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and prevent further damage.
Small Water Spill on Floor Yes No A small water spill on the floor is usually an easy fix and can be handled with DIY equipment.

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Cost in Vista, ID

The cost of Emergency Water Removal (24/7) can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Vista, ID. Our estimates are based on the actual cost of the work and not a fixed price.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ted, the size of the affected area, and the equipment used.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the type of equipment used, and the amount of time required.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area, the type of equipment used, and the level of contamination.
Final Inspection and Repair $500 – $2,000 The extent of the damage, the type of repairs required, and the materials used.
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Package $2,000 – $10,000 The sever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the equipment used.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ates for all our services.
